Offshore Pipeline Complexities: Why Smart Pigging Matters
Offshore pipelines face more extreme conditions than their onshore counterparts. Fluctuating operating conditions, aggressive environments, and difficult accessibility create heightened risks. For pipeline operators, regular inspection is not just best practice—it’s vital. The pipeline system must be continuously monitored for threats such as internal and external corrosion, metal loss, and decreased pipe wall strength.
Smart pigging combines advanced pipeline inspection tools with robust inspection techniques to deliver real-time data. These tools are essential in conducting detailed pipeline inspection without halting the operation. The ability to deploy inline inspection tools safely and repeatedly in offshore pipelines supports both operational efficiency and regulatory compliance.
Key Smart Pig Technologies for Offshore Environment
A variety of pipeline pig types are available, but not all are optimized for offshore applications. Selecting the right pipeline pig depends on material type, fluid dynamics, and geography. Common types of pigs used offshore include:
- Cleaning pigs for debris removal and pipeline cleaning
- Intelligent pigs for data-rich ultrasonic inspection
- Utility pigs for gauging and general maintenance
- Inspection pigs equipped with magnetic flux leakage (MFL) or ultrasonic testing (UT) sensors
Pipeline inspection gauges (PIGs) are tailored for offshore pigging operations, where deploying and retrieving pigs must happen via specialized launchers under pressure and at depth. These pigs are designed for a wide range of tasks from corrosion mapping to crack detection.
Core Challenges in Offshore Pigging Operations
Offshore pigging operations face logistical and technical barriers:
- Limited access to pigging equipment
- Harsh subsea conditions affecting inspection technology
- Safety protocols for pressurized pigging service
- Need for high-resolution, real-time data analysis
Environmental pressure, high flow rates, and the subsea infrastructure itself often constrain the types of tools that can be used. However, smart pigs—particularly pipeline smart pigs equipped with MFL or UT—enable accurate pipeline inspection services and pipeline maintenance, even in these challenging scenarios.
Smart Pigs as a Cost-Effective Inspection Solution
While offshore smart pigging can appear cost-prohibitive at first glance, its value lies in preventing corrosion, leak detection, and long-term pipeline corrosion protection. The combination of magnetic fields and ultrasonic waves allows these devices to pinpoint flaws in the pipe wall or detect corrosion cracks, reducing downtime and mitigating spill risks.
Smart pigs also offer flexible deployment for various types of pipeline, including gas pipelines and multi-phase liquid pipelines. Many are pigs designed to adapt to multiple diameters or navigate bends, ensuring that no segment is left uninspected.
